align app copy and helpers with beOS naming
This commit is contained in:
@@ -34,11 +34,11 @@
|
||||
<script lang="ts" setup>
|
||||
import { ref, PropType, computed } from 'vue';
|
||||
import { getNftUrl } from './encoder';
|
||||
import { OlaresInfo } from '@bytetrade/core';
|
||||
import { BeOSInfo } from 'src/utils/beos-core';
|
||||
|
||||
const props = defineProps({
|
||||
info: {
|
||||
type: Object as PropType<OlaresInfo>,
|
||||
type: Object as PropType<BeOSInfo>,
|
||||
require: false
|
||||
},
|
||||
size: {
|
||||
|
||||
@@ -4,7 +4,7 @@ import {
|
||||
BackupFrequency,
|
||||
BackupLocation,
|
||||
IntegrationAccountMiniData
|
||||
} from '@bytetrade/core';
|
||||
} from 'src/utils/beos-core';
|
||||
|
||||
import { i18n } from '../boot/i18n';
|
||||
import { getRequireImage } from '../utils/rss-utils';
|
||||
|
||||
@@ -46,7 +46,7 @@ import { useI18n } from 'vue-i18n';
|
||||
import { parsingMnemonics } from '../../Mobile/login/account/ImportUserBusiness';
|
||||
import TerminusPageTitle from '../../../components/common/TerminusPageTitle.vue';
|
||||
import { importUser } from '../../../utils/BindTerminusBusiness';
|
||||
import { TerminusDefaultDomain, TerminusInfo } from '@bytetrade/core';
|
||||
import { TerminusDefaultDomain, TerminusInfo } from 'src/utils/beos-core';
|
||||
import PadInputContentScrollView from '../../../components/ios/PadInputContentScrollView.vue';
|
||||
import {
|
||||
notifyWarning,
|
||||
|
||||
@@ -39,7 +39,7 @@
|
||||
<script lang="ts" setup>
|
||||
import { ref, onMounted, onUnmounted, onBeforeUnmount } from 'vue';
|
||||
import { useUserStore } from '../../../../stores/user';
|
||||
import { OlaresInfo } from '@bytetrade/core';
|
||||
import { BeOSInfo } from 'src/utils/beos-core';
|
||||
import { useQuasar } from 'quasar';
|
||||
import { useRouter } from 'vue-router';
|
||||
import axios from 'axios';
|
||||
@@ -118,7 +118,7 @@ async function updateTerminusInfo(): Promise<string | undefined> {
|
||||
updateTerminusInfoIng = true;
|
||||
|
||||
try {
|
||||
const data: OlaresInfo = await getBeOSInfo(baseURL, 5000, {
|
||||
const data: BeOSInfo = await getBeOSInfo(baseURL, 5000, {
|
||||
t: new Date().getTime()
|
||||
});
|
||||
|
||||
|
||||
@@ -66,7 +66,7 @@ import {
|
||||
notifyWarning
|
||||
} from '../../../../utils/notifyRedefinedUtil';
|
||||
import { onUnmounted } from 'vue';
|
||||
import { TerminusDefaultDomain, TerminusInfo } from '@bytetrade/core';
|
||||
import { TerminusDefaultDomain, TerminusInfo } from 'src/utils/beos-core';
|
||||
import { getBeOSInfo as getBaseBeOSInfo } from '../../../../utils/account';
|
||||
|
||||
const $q = useQuasar();
|
||||
|
||||
@@ -321,7 +321,7 @@ import { useBackupStore } from 'src/stores/settings/backup';
|
||||
import { useDeviceStore } from 'src/stores/settings/device';
|
||||
import { computed, onMounted, ref } from 'vue';
|
||||
import { BtDialog, useColor } from '@bytetrade/ui';
|
||||
import { BackupFrequency } from '@bytetrade/core';
|
||||
import { BackupFrequency } from 'src/utils/beos-core';
|
||||
import { useRoute, useRouter } from 'vue-router';
|
||||
import { FilePath } from 'src/stores/files';
|
||||
import { useQuasar } from 'quasar';
|
||||
|
||||
@@ -5,7 +5,7 @@ import {
|
||||
DesktopAppInfo,
|
||||
DesktopPosition
|
||||
} from '@apps/desktop/type/types';
|
||||
import { TerminusApp, TerminusEntrance } from '@bytetrade/core';
|
||||
import { TerminusApp, TerminusEntrance } from 'src/utils/beos-core';
|
||||
import { useTokenStore } from './token';
|
||||
import { AppInfo } from 'src/utils/interface/applications';
|
||||
import { SearchCategory } from 'src/utils/interface/search';
|
||||
|
||||
@@ -31,7 +31,7 @@ import { i18n } from 'src/boot/i18n';
|
||||
import { busEmit, busOff, busOn } from 'src/utils/bus';
|
||||
import { passwordAddSort } from 'src/utils/account';
|
||||
import { getDID, getPrivateJWK } from 'src/did/did-key';
|
||||
import { compareOlaresVersion, GolbalHost, PrivateJwk } from '@bytetrade/core';
|
||||
import { compareBeOSVersion, GolbalHost, PrivateJwk } from 'src/utils/beos-core';
|
||||
import { signJWS } from 'src/layouts/dialog/sign';
|
||||
import { axiosInstanceProxy } from 'src/platform/httpProxy';
|
||||
import { UpgradeMode } from 'src/constant/beos';
|
||||
@@ -112,7 +112,7 @@ export const useMDNSStore = defineStore('mdnsStore', {
|
||||
return this.mdnsMachine;
|
||||
}
|
||||
if (
|
||||
compareOlaresVersion(
|
||||
compareBeOSVersion(
|
||||
this.apiMachine.status.terminusVersion,
|
||||
apiMachineMineVersion
|
||||
).compare < 0
|
||||
@@ -351,7 +351,7 @@ export const useMDNSStore = defineStore('mdnsStore', {
|
||||
}
|
||||
|
||||
return (
|
||||
compareOlaresVersion(
|
||||
compareBeOSVersion(
|
||||
activeM.status.terminusVersion,
|
||||
activeM.version.upgradeableVersion
|
||||
).compare < 0
|
||||
@@ -1325,7 +1325,7 @@ export const useMDNSStore = defineStore('mdnsStore', {
|
||||
}
|
||||
},
|
||||
isNewActivedMineVersion(version: string) {
|
||||
return compareOlaresVersion(version, newActivedMineVersion).compare >= 0;
|
||||
return compareBeOSVersion(version, newActivedMineVersion).compare >= 0;
|
||||
}
|
||||
}
|
||||
});
|
||||
|
||||
@@ -1,7 +1,7 @@
|
||||
import axios from 'axios';
|
||||
import { defineStore } from 'pinia';
|
||||
import { useTokenStore } from './token';
|
||||
import { SpaceSaveData, Secret } from '@bytetrade/core';
|
||||
import { SpaceSaveData, Secret } from 'src/utils/beos-core';
|
||||
import { remoteSpaceUrl } from 'src/constant/index';
|
||||
|
||||
export interface AccountData {
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
import { IntegrationAccount } from 'src/services/abstractions/integration/integrationService';
|
||||
import integrationService from 'src/services/integration/index';
|
||||
import { AccountType, IntegrationAccountMiniData } from '@bytetrade/core';
|
||||
import { AccountType, IntegrationAccountMiniData } from 'src/utils/beos-core';
|
||||
import { useTokenStore } from './token';
|
||||
import { defineStore } from 'pinia';
|
||||
import axios from 'axios';
|
||||
|
||||
@@ -2,12 +2,12 @@ import { defineStore } from 'pinia';
|
||||
import {
|
||||
PrivateJwk,
|
||||
TerminusInfo,
|
||||
OlaresInfo,
|
||||
BeOSInfo,
|
||||
Token,
|
||||
DefaultTerminusInfo,
|
||||
DefaultOlaresInfo,
|
||||
DefaultBeOSInfo,
|
||||
TerminusDefaultDomain
|
||||
} from '@bytetrade/core';
|
||||
} from 'src/utils/beos-core';
|
||||
import {
|
||||
LocalUserVault,
|
||||
UserItem,
|
||||
@@ -89,7 +89,7 @@ export interface UserSate {
|
||||
defaultDomain: DefaultDomainValueType;
|
||||
}
|
||||
|
||||
export let UsersTerminusInfo: Record<string, OlaresInfo | undefined> = {};
|
||||
export let UsersTerminusInfo: Record<string, BeOSInfo | undefined> = {};
|
||||
|
||||
export const useUserStore = defineStore('user', {
|
||||
state: () => {
|
||||
@@ -871,13 +871,13 @@ export const useUserStore = defineStore('user', {
|
||||
}
|
||||
},
|
||||
|
||||
currentUserSaveTerminusInfo(terminusInfo: OlaresInfo | undefined) {
|
||||
currentUserSaveTerminusInfo(terminusInfo: BeOSInfo | undefined) {
|
||||
UsersTerminusInfo[this.current_id || ''] = terminusInfo;
|
||||
},
|
||||
|
||||
async setUserTerminusInfo(
|
||||
userId: string,
|
||||
terminusInfo: OlaresInfo | undefined
|
||||
terminusInfo: BeOSInfo | undefined
|
||||
) {
|
||||
if (terminusInfo) {
|
||||
UsersTerminusInfo[userId] = terminusInfo;
|
||||
@@ -902,7 +902,7 @@ export const useUserStore = defineStore('user', {
|
||||
getUserTerminusInfo(userId: string) {
|
||||
return (
|
||||
UsersTerminusInfo[userId] || {
|
||||
...DefaultOlaresInfo,
|
||||
...DefaultBeOSInfo,
|
||||
olaresId: this.users?.items.get(userId)?.name || ''
|
||||
}
|
||||
);
|
||||
@@ -915,7 +915,7 @@ export const useUserStore = defineStore('user', {
|
||||
|
||||
terminusInfo() {
|
||||
const olaresInfo = UsersTerminusInfo[this.current_id || ''] || {
|
||||
...DefaultOlaresInfo,
|
||||
...DefaultBeOSInfo,
|
||||
olaresId: this.current_user?.name || ''
|
||||
};
|
||||
return olaresInfo;
|
||||
|
||||
@@ -1,4 +1,4 @@
|
||||
import { OlaresInfo, TerminusInfo, Token } from '@bytetrade/core';
|
||||
import { BeOSInfo, TerminusInfo, Token } from 'src/utils/beos-core';
|
||||
import { axiosInstanceProxy } from 'src/platform/httpProxy';
|
||||
import { i18n } from '../boot/i18n';
|
||||
import { saltedMD5 } from './salted-md5';
|
||||
@@ -174,7 +174,7 @@ export const getTerminusInfo = async (
|
||||
(baseURL.endsWith('/') ? baseURL : baseURL + '/') +
|
||||
'bfl/info/v1/terminus-info'
|
||||
);
|
||||
const terminusInfo: OlaresInfo = res.data.data;
|
||||
const terminusInfo: BeOSInfo = res.data.data;
|
||||
return terminusInfo;
|
||||
};
|
||||
|
||||
@@ -199,7 +199,7 @@ export const getBeOSInfo = async (
|
||||
(baseURL.endsWith('/') ? baseURL : baseURL + '/') +
|
||||
'bfl/info/v1/beos-info'
|
||||
);
|
||||
const terminusInfo: OlaresInfo = res.data.data;
|
||||
const terminusInfo: BeOSInfo = res.data.data;
|
||||
return terminusInfo;
|
||||
} catch (error) {
|
||||
return await getTerminusInfo(baseURL, timeout, params);
|
||||
|
||||
4
apps/packages/app/src/utils/beos-core.ts
Normal file
4
apps/packages/app/src/utils/beos-core.ts
Normal file
@@ -0,0 +1,4 @@
|
||||
export * from '@bytetrade/core';
|
||||
export { compareOlaresVersion as compareBeOSVersion } from '@bytetrade/core';
|
||||
export { DefaultOlaresInfo as DefaultBeOSInfo } from '@bytetrade/core';
|
||||
export type { OlaresInfo as BeOSInfo } from '@bytetrade/core';
|
||||
Reference in New Issue
Block a user